Pôle Muséal Lausanne is an initiative that puts together three of the most relevant cultural institutions in the Swiss city. Two competitions defining the diverse programs were launched in 2011 and 2015. This project follows the second part of this process.

The Barcelona-based Estudio Barozzi-Veiga EBV was awarded in 2011 with the first prize for the competition dealing with the design of the largest of the three museums, MCB-A among other programs. Their proposal had also a big roll defining the remaining space and it's urban use.\nLast year the second part of this competition, dealing with the design of the two remaining institutions, was launched. \nThe project here presented follows the calendar and process almost at parallel, and is a chance to deal with a real program and to develop architectural scenarios at the same time as some of the most relevant practices world-wide. At the same time it is an opportunity to study further the work of a practice I followed and a chance to develop a strong thesis about an urban space and a cultural hub inside a well known environment.
